One of the biggest recent advancements in golf technology and also one of the most talked about, Zero torque putters have taken the golfing world by storm. Engineered to minimise head rotation through the stroke, keeping the putter face square at impact for a straighter, more consistent roll. 

These putters feature carefully designed shaft and weight placements to reduce twisting, giving confidence to players who struggle with face rotation. Pros and amateurs alike are making the change to zero torque putters meaning no matter your ability these can help your game on the greens.

A zero torque putter is designed to reduce twisting of the putter face during the stroke. This is usually achieved by positioning the shaft closer to the centre of gravity of the putter head, helping keep the putter square to the target line throughout the motion with the goal of making the stroke more stable and repeatable.

Zero torque putters are best suited to golfers who want maximum stability and face control during the putting stroke. They are particularly helpful for players who accidentally open or close the face during the stroke.

Several golf brands now make versions of zero torque putters. Although first introduced by L.A.B golf. Taylormade, Callaway, PING and Scotty Cameron have all followed suit and made their own unique adaptations.

Zero torque putters are so expensive because they are the latest major advancement in golf technology and they require specialised engineering with precise balancing to align the shaft and centre of gravity correctly. Many models are precision milled with premium materials also increasing manufacturing costs.

With the trend of Zero Torque putters taking off, all the major golf brands rushed to make their own versions, and the Spider ZT is Taylormade's model. The Zero Torque design is built to help prevent face rotation through the stroke so you get a more consistent stroke on the greens.

Square 2 Square is Odysseys answer to the Zero Torque technology trend taking the golf world by storm right now. Designed to keep the face square through impact and prevent any unwanted twisting, these are meant to make it easier golf golfers to produce a more consistent stroke on the greens.

Bettinardi SB putters stand for "simply balanced" and represents their zero torque lineup. With the centre of gravity perfectly in the centre of the putter, more strokes stay naturally on path and square from start to finish.
